I used to use BFG 275/60-15 drag radials and the Eibachs it had on it made them rub so I put stock springs back in the rear. I'm going to put the Eibach springs back in it this weekend to see if that makes it any better.

Either way I'm saving for a double adjustable coil-over set on the rear. I don't think the front looks to bad and maybe pulling the rear down some will even out the front.
